A civil engineer whose research on Mithila’s rivers is treated as a landmark in "Ecological Maithili Literature". His works, such as The Kamla River and People on Collision Course and Bandini Mahananda, provide a scientific pratyakṣa of the failure of centralized embankments, which he labels an "engineering sin".
